In July 1958, Donald Byrd made a lengthy visit to Europe, not returning Stateside until December. He fronted a fine quintet that gave concert appearances at festivals held in many countries, Knokke-le-Zoute (Belgium), Cannes (France), Sweden, Norway, Germany – and an engagement at the Paris jazz club “Au Chat Qui Pêche”, a few days after their concert at the Olympia.

The group felt very comfortable at the club on rue de la Huchette, and it soon becam a second home for them. In November and December 1958, Donald Byrd and his men were invited by the French Radio to make some recordings session. Sam Records is proud to presents this previously unreleased studio session recorded for the French Radio Television Show ‘Jazz aux Champs-Elysées’.

PERSONNEL:

  • Donald Byrd - (trumpet)
  • Bobby Jaspar - (flute/tTenor saxophone)
  • Walter Davis Jr./Jacques Diéval - (piano)
  • Doug Watkins/Jacques Hess -(bass)
  • Art Taylor/Daniel Humair - (drums)

Recorded in Paris, November & December, 1958.
